WordPress.com とアプリを連携する新 REST API
新しい REST アプリケーション・プログラミング・インターフェース (API) を公開しました。開発者のみなさんはこれを使って WordPress.com 上にある多数のサイトコミュニティと連携し、データの取得、サイトの操作、追加コンテンツの作成などを行えます。
新しい REST アプリケーション・プログラミング・インターフェース (API) を公開しました。開発者のみなさんはこれを使って WordPress.com 上にある多数のサイトコミュニティと連携し、データの取得、サイトの操作、追加コンテンツの作成などを行えます。将来は、Jetpack プラグインを有効化したインストール型 WordPress サイトとの連携も可能になる予定です。
この API は開発者に投稿・コメントへのアクセスを許可し、サイトのフォロー、コンテンツに対する「いいね」やリブログを可能にします。また、毎日編集者が手作業で選んでいる Freshly Pressed(英語版ホームページの投稿セレクション)のコンテンツなども API を通して入手可能です。
新しい API を使ったアプリの良い例として、すでに入手できるようになっている Windows 8 WordPress.com アプリがあります。
僕らが考えるこの新 API のゴールは「WordPress.com 上にあるデータの利用やコンテンツの追加をシンプルにする」ということです。このため、データのリクエストを認証するのに OAuth2 プロトコルを使っています。公開データを取得する場合は認証なしのリクエストが可能ですが、新規投稿やコメントの追加などといった操作を行うには、認証リクエストが必要になります。API からのデータは、使いやすい標準 JSON オブジェクトで返すようにしました。
また、この REST API は自身でドキュメンテーションを作成できます。新しいエンドポイントが追加されると、開発者リソースブログが自動的に更新され、最新の情報を提供します。さらに、開発者用コンソールへのアクセスによって、実際の REST API クエリを実行して JSON データをブラウザで見ることができます。コンソールについて詳しくは、こちらをお読みください [en]。
WordPress.com と連携するアプリを作る準備ができましたか?承認サイクルを待たずに、OAuth2 トークンをすぐに登録・管理できます。API に関するご質問やご意見があれば、ご連絡ください。開発者リソースブログをフォローして、REST API やその他の連携用サービスのニュースや最新情報、ドキュメンテーションをチェックするのもお忘れなく。
この記事は Tim Moore が WordPress.com 英語版ブログに投稿した「Integrate Cool Applications with WordPress.com」の訳です。機能について不明な点があればコメント欄または日本語フォーラムでご質問ください。
翻訳: マクラケン直子
- 2012年4月13日
- 新機能
ogswr.wordpress.com ( @ogasawaramakoto )
でリブログ.
いいねいいね